| Kailash Yatra | |
| This is the most important of all the Shiva pilgrimages. Kailash is a name of mountain in Tibet (China). It is the abode of Lord Shiva himself. It is a tough pilgrimage, and is annually organised by Govt of India with the help of Govts of Nepal & China. Pilgrims have to undergo medical fitness tests to see whether they can stand the rigorous journey. |

| Five Panchamahabhuta Shivlinga | |
| They are all situated in South India
where Lord Shiva is worshipped in the form of five basic elements. They are : |
|
| 1. Akasa : Chidambareshwar
(Chidambaram) |
|
| 2. Vayu : Kalahastishwar (near
Tirupati) |
|
| 3. Agni : Arunachalam
(Tiruvanamalai) |
|
| 4. Jala : Jambukeshwar (Near Sriramgam) | |
| 5. Prithvi : Shivkanchi (in Kanchi) |

| Lord Pashupatinath | |
| On the southern side of River Vaghmati is situated the capital of Nepal Kathmandu. In the devpattan locality is situated this famous temple. |
